Stanbic IBTC USSD code is *909#. It allows customers to transfer money, buy airtime and data, check their account balance, pay electricity and cable television bills, open an account, request a debit card, apply for selected loans, obtain a bank statement, and block an account without using mobile data.
To start using the service, dial *909*11*1# from the phone number registered with your Stanbic IBTC account. You can verify your identity with either your debit card or BVN, then create a four-digit transaction PIN.
Stanbic IBTC provides separate transfer codes for payments within the bank and transfers to other Nigerian banks. Dial *909*11*amount*account number# for a Stanbic IBTC beneficiary or *909*22*amount*account number# for another bank.
You can also dial *909*1*1# to check your account balance, *909*8# to buy data, *909*37# to open an instant account, and *909*1*911# to block account access when your phone or SIM is lost.

How to Register Stanbic IBTC USSD Code
The current registration code is:
*909*11*1#
Use the phone number connected to your Stanbic IBTC account.
Register With Your Debit Card
- Dial *909*11*1#.
- Select Debit Card as your verification method.
- Enter the last six digits of your Stanbic IBTC debit card.
- Enter your date of birth in the DDMMYYYY format.
- Create a four-digit transaction PIN.
- Re-enter the PIN.
- Wait for the successful registration message.
For example, someone born on 7 March 1990 would enter:
07031990
Register With Your BVN
- Dial *909*11*1#.
- Select BVN.
- Enter your Bank Verification Number.
- Enter your date of birth in the DDMMYYYY format.
- Create a four-digit transaction PIN.
- Confirm the PIN.
- Wait for the activation message.
The date of birth must match the information held by Stanbic IBTC and linked to your BVN.

Stanbic IBTC Transfer Code
Stanbic IBTC provides separate direct codes for intrabank and interbank transfers.
Transfer to Another Stanbic IBTC Account
Dial:
*909*11*amount*account number#
For example, to send ₦10,000 to account number 0123456789, dial:
*909*11*10000*0123456789#
Then:
- Check the beneficiary name.
- Select the account to debit if prompted.
- Review the amount.
- Enter your transaction PIN.
- Wait for the confirmation message.
Transfer to Another Nigerian Bank
Dial:
*909*22*amount*account number#
For example:
*909*22*10000*0123456789#
You will then select the receiving bank, confirm the recipient’s name, and authorise the payment with your transaction PIN.
The difference between the codes is important:
- 11 is used for a Stanbic IBTC beneficiary.
- 22 is used for another Nigerian bank.

Stanbic IBTC Transfer Limit
Stanbic IBTC does not publish one current universal USSD transfer limit that applies to every account on its public *909# page.
Your actual limit may depend on:
- Account type
- Account verification tier
- Available balance
- Daily transaction history
- Regulatory requirements
- Security profile
- Risk controls
- Whether you use a Stanbic IBTC account or @ease wallet
- Restrictions placed on the account
A basic or lower-tier account can have a smaller limit than a fully verified current or savings account.
The USSD platform should reject an amount above the limit available on your profile.
For a larger transfer, use the Stanbic IBTC mobile app, internet banking, an ATM, or visit a branch.
Stanbic IBTC Transfer Charges
A transfer may attract:
- A bank transfer fee
- Value-added tax
- Electronic transfer levies where applicable
- A ₦6.98 mobile-network USSD charge
- Charges connected to the receiving service
The bank’s transfer fee can depend on the amount and receiving bank.
Always check the total charge displayed before entering your PIN.
The USSD access fee is normally deducted from your airtime balance, while the transfer amount and bank fee are deducted from your account.

Stanbic IBTC Code to Block Account Access
The emergency account-blocking code is:
*909*1*911#
Use it immediately when:
- Your phone is stolen
- Your SIM is missing
- You suspect a SIM swap
- Someone knows your transaction PIN
- You disclose an OTP
- Your mobile app is compromised
- You receive an unauthorised debit alert
- You lose control of the registered phone number
How to Block the Account
- Dial *909*1*911#.
- Follow the displayed security prompts.
- Enter the transaction PIN or requested information.
- Confirm the blocking instruction.
- Contact Stanbic IBTC customer care.
Stanbic IBTC’s terms state that the block request is validated with the transaction PIN.
If you cannot use USSD, call the bank immediately.

Transfer Failed but I Was Debited
Stanbic IBTC’s USSD terms advise customers not to resend the same instruction before checking their account statement or contacting the bank.
This is because the first transaction may still be processed, and repeating it can cause a double debit.
Take these steps:
- Check your account balance.
- Confirm whether the beneficiary received the money.
- Review transaction history in the mobile app.
- Save the debit alert.
- Record the transaction reference.
- Note the amount, date, time, receiving bank, and beneficiary account.
- Wait for an automatic reversal.
- Contact Stanbic IBTC when the reversal does not arrive.
Do not share your PIN or OTP when reporting the transaction.
